作 者:牛铁泉[1] 王燕燕 高燕[1] 张鹏飞[1] 张小军[1] 刘群龙[1] NIU Tiequan;WANG Yanyan;GAO Yan;ZHANG Pengfei;ZHANG Xiaojun;LILT Qunlong(College of Horticulture,Shanxi Agricultural University,Taigu,Shanxi 030801)
出 处:《北方园艺》2018年第24期41-47,共7页Northern Horticulture
基 金:山西省科技攻关资助项目(20140311017-5)
摘 要:以6年生‘清香’核桃为试材,在落叶前(PBD)、落叶后(PAD)、严冬期(WP)、萌芽前(PBG)和萌芽后(PAG)等不同时期修剪,并以不修剪为对照(CK),研究了不同时期修剪对核桃叶片主要营养元素周年动态变化规律的影响,以期为核桃合理修剪时期的确立提供参考依据。结果表明:在N、P、K、Ca、Mg含量上,各处理间无显著差异,而在Fe、Mn、Zn、Cu含量上,PAD表现突出,常常处于最高水平,PAG、PBD表现次之,WP则表现较差。故此,修剪时期以PAD最佳,PAG、PBD次之,WP最差。The cultivar of 6-year-old ‘Qingxiang’ walnut was used as material and pruned respectively in different time.The pruning periods were pruning before defoliation(PBD),pruning after defoliation(PAD),winter pruning(WP),pruning before germination(PBG),pruning after germination(PAG) and untrimmed(CK).The effect of different pruning period on seasonal changes of nutrient elements content of walnut leaves were studied in order to provide reasonable reference for pruning period of walnut.The results showed that contents of N,P,K,Ca and Mg in leaves among different pruning time was no significant difference.Contents of Fe,Mn,Zn and Cu in leaves after pruning were superior to CK,and were distinctly higher in leaves of PAD and relatively low in leaves of PAG and PBD,lowest in leaves of WP.Thus the best pruning time was PAD,next were PAG and PBD.The effect of WP was the worst.
